11th and last PAK FA prototype being assembled

Posted on January 24, 2016 by alert5

Head of the Russian Air Force said the 11th and last PAK FA prototype is being assembled at Komsomolsk-on-Amur.

Raytheon awarded research contract for their version of CUDA

Posted on January 23, 2016January 23, 2016 by alert5

The U.S. Air Force Research Laboratory has awarded Raytheon a $14 million contract to research on two concepts for next-generation, air-launched, tactical missiles.

Qatar wants 73 F-15Es

Posted on January 23, 2016January 23, 2016 by alert5

According to U.S. Senate Foreign Relations Chairman Bob Corker, Qatar is requesting to buy as many as 73 Boeing F-15Es.

MDA hopes to trial laser-armed UAV for ABM defense in 2021

Posted on January 23, 2016January 22, 2016 by alert5

More details have emerged on the Missile Defense Agency’s plan to fit a laser weapon on a high flying unmanned aerial vehicle in order to destroy ballistic missiles at the boost-phase.

Low price of oil could derail Norway’s F-35 purchase

Posted on January 23, 2016January 22, 2016 by alert5

Flight Global says media in Norway are saying that the low price of oil is putting pressure on the Norwegian government’s plan to buy all 52 F-35As.
